when using multipule frag3 rules does their order make a diffreence in funtionality? is... preprocessor frag3_engine: policy first, detect_anomalies preprocessor frag3_engine: policy bsd, bind_to [1.1.1.1] preprocessor frag3_engine: policy linux, bind_to [1.1.1.3,1.1.1.4,1.1.1.5] function that same as.. preprocessor frag3_engine: policy linux, bind_to [1.1.1.3,1.1.1.4,1.1.1.5] preprocessor frag3_engine: policy bsd, bind_to [1.1.2.0/24] preprocessor frag3_engine: policy first, detect_anomalies I always thaught that eirlier ststements kind of acted as filters for the final statement which is kind of a catch all for every thing not previously defined, but I'm not sure if the actual order plays a part in this. If ithe 'policy first' config is first in line will every thing use that frag3? Wally ------------------------------------------------------------------------- Using Tomcat but need to do more?
